17.07.2013 Views

24.2.2005 Nr. 9/479 EØS-tillegget til Den europeiske unions ... - EFTA

24.2.2005 Nr. 9/479 EØS-tillegget til Den europeiske unions ... - EFTA

24.2.2005 Nr. 9/479 EØS-tillegget til Den europeiske unions ... - EFTA

SHOW MORE
SHOW LESS

Create successful ePaper yourself

Turn your PDF publications into a flip-book with our unique Google optimized e-Paper software.

<strong>24.2.2005</strong> <strong>EØS</strong>-<strong><strong>til</strong>legget</strong> <strong>til</strong> <strong>Den</strong> <strong>europeiske</strong> <strong>unions</strong> tidende<br />

<strong>Nr</strong>. 9/581<br />

5.3. Algoritme for beregning av kryptografiske kontrollsummer<br />

CSM_028 Kryptografiske kontrollsummer er bygd opp med en vanlig MAC i samsvar med ANSI X9.19 med DES:<br />

– innledende trinn: <strong>Den</strong> innledende kontrollblokken y0 er E(Ka, SSC).<br />

– sekvensielt trinn: Kontrollblokkene y1, ..., yn beregnes ved hjelp av Ka.<br />

– sluttrinn: <strong>Den</strong> kryptografiske kontrollsummen beregnes slik ut fra den siste kontrollblokken yn: E(Ka, D(Kb,<br />

yn)),<br />

der E() betyr kryptering med DES, og D() betyr dekryptering med DES.<br />

De fire mest signifikante byte i den kryptografiske kontrollsummen overføres.<br />

CSM_029 Sendesekvenstelleren (SSC) skal startes under framgangsmåten for enighet om nøkler med:<br />

Startverdi for SSC: Rnd3 (4 minst signifikante byte) || Rnd1 (4 minst signifikante byte).<br />

CSM_030 Sendesekvenstelleren skal hver gang økes med 1 før beregning av en MAC (dvs. SSC for den første kommandoen er<br />

startverdien av SSC + 1, SSC for det første svaret er startverdien av SSC + 2).<br />

Følgende figur viser beregningen av vanlig MAC:<br />

KRYPTER<br />

5.4. Algoritme for beregning av kryptogrammer for fortrolighetsdataobjekter<br />

CSM_031 Kryptogrammer beregnes ved hjelp av TDEA i TCBC-modus i samsvar med referansene TDES og TDES-OP og med<br />

nullvektoren som startverdiblokk.<br />

Følgende figur viser anvendelsen av nøkler i TDES:<br />

TDES-kryptering<br />

Data<br />

TDES-dekryptering<br />

E(K, data)<br />

KRYPTER<br />

DEKRYPTER<br />

KRYPTER KRYPTER KRYPTER<br />

DEKRYPTER<br />

KRYPTER<br />

KRYPTER<br />

DEKRYPTER<br />

DEKRYPTER<br />

KRYPTER<br />

(4 mest signifikante<br />

E(K, data)<br />

Data

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!